Title :
Spatially selective optical biosensing based on the transmission through nanoslit arrays

Abstract :
Metal nanoslit arrays are investigated to tailor the electromagnetic field distribution and the relative contribution of cavity modes and surface plasmon polariton modes for refractive index sensing, permitting spatially selective sensing for optical biosensing applications.
